Why This Name Might Not Exist
There are several possibilities for why you might have encountered this name without finding substantial growing information:
- It could be a misspelling of a similar-sounding genus
- It might be an outdated or invalid taxonomic name that’s no longer used
- It could be a regional common name that’s been confused with a scientific name
- It may have been incorrectly entered in a database or publication

Alternative Native Grass Options
Since the name Phaeosporobolus contains elements suggesting it might be related to grasses, here are some wonderful native grass alternatives that might fit what you’re looking for:
- Sporobolus species (dropseed grasses) – drought-tolerant native grasses perfect for naturalistic landscapes
- Panicum species (panic grasses) – versatile native grasses with beautiful fall color
- Andropogon species (bluestem grasses) – iconic prairie grasses that support wildlife
